Program Details
Gain further competency in your leadership skills and develop your own methods to teach and lead students in K-12 settings with this online master’s in education administration. This program builds on prior teaching experience and provides the additional knowledge and skills needed to become a K-12 principal.
This program emphasizes courses in leadership issues specific to education, such as:
- Instructional leadership
- Curriculum development
- Community relations
All students complete an in-depth supervised internship in elementary, middle, and high schools. Graduates will qualify for the Wyoming principal certification, which readies them for building principalship.
